JsonEncoder constructor
- Object? toEncodable(
- dynamic object
Creates a JSON encoder.
The JSON encoder handles numbers, strings, booleans, null, lists and maps with string keys directly.
Any other object is attempted converted by toEncodable to an
object that is of one of the convertible types.
If toEncodable is omitted, it defaults to calling .toJson() on
the object.
Implementation
const JsonEncoder([Object? toEncodable(dynamic object)?])
: indent = null,
_toEncodable = toEncodable;
